Insurance Management
Summary
This enhancement to Quick Search introduces a new configuration option to prevent returning inactive carriers in Carrier Quick Search results unless a user has special permissions.
As was the case previously, a Carrier Search from Manage Policies will display only active carriers. However, the Quick Search version of the Carrier Search (in the upper-right of the main RIS screen) returns the inactive carriers also. This could be confusing for most users, but helpful for certain types of users who work closely with insurance configuration in the RIS.
With this change, a new Clinical.CarrierSearch.QuickSearchInactive RIS Access String controls who can see inactive carriers when using the Carrier Search option in the Quick Search box.
The default behavior for this new setting is to display only active carriers. Only users who are insurance experts should be given permissions to include inactive carriers in their search.
Configuration Instructions
System Administrators must complete the following actions to enable this feature:
RIS Client
Changes to RIS Access String Settings
ยท Grant Clinical.CarrierSearch.QuickSearchInactive permissions as necessary.
